Front Panel
Channel Faders — Channel 1, 2 and 3 correspond to the mic inputs (1,2, & 3)
Stereo VU Display (LED) — Blue LEDs -12dB, -9dB, -6dB, -3dB, 0dB and red LED +3dB
Low Cut Filters — The three position switch, 140HZ, 20HZ, and 100HZ at 12dB per octave
Pan Switches — Channel 1, 2, and 3 channel 3 pan switches (right, center and left)
Reference Tone — 0dBVU 400HZ low distortion sine wave
Slate Mic — Low noise slate mic to right and left outputs
Power Monitor — LED flashes on and off for normal power (voltage) and continuously on for low power
Battery Test Switch — Battery voltage is indicated on the right LED display
Power Switch — Mixer powering INT (batteries), EXT (external power) and OFF
RTN Mix Switch — Switches phones from external source to mixerv
HP Monitor Switch — CTR = Stereo, RT = Right Ear (R+L), LT = Left Ear (L+R)
Left Side Panel
Mic Inputs, Channel 1, 2, and 3 — XLR electronically balanced
Mic Powering — 48 phantom and dynamic
Mic-Line Switch — MIC or LINE (-50dB attenuation)
Preamplifier Gain — Switchable attenuation 10dB, 20dB and 0dB
HP Volume — Headphone volume control
VU LED — Switchable display brightness: bright (sunlight), normal, and off
Limiter — Limiter in/out switchable

Right Side Panel
Phone Jack — 1/4” stereo
Slate Volume — Screwdriver volume adjustment
XLR Mic-Line Outputs — Right and left line outputs, switchable MIC or LINE levels
External Power — Mixer powering from an external DC power source of 9-18VDC (Hirose 4-pin connector, pin 4 +V, pin 1 -V)
Return — 3.5mm stereo jack
LINK/AUX OUT — 5-pin TA connector; link to Wendt X5 Mixer (pin 1 right, pin 3 left); AUX OUT (pin 2 right, pin 4 left), switchable (AUX switch) MIC-LINE. AUX outputs can be configured to Mono Out by shorting Right to Left pins in mating connector.
Battery Compartment — Six AA batteries
